The Milton Community Youth Coalition (MCYC) is dedicated to preventing young people from abusing alcohol, tobacco, and other drugs. MCYC educates students, engages families, and mentors youth. Last year, with our community partners, MCYC reached over 1100 children, teens, young adults, and families throughout Milton through the following programs:
• MCYC taught 512 students in elementary and middle school health classes about the dangers and the impact of alcohol, tobacco and other drugs.
• Last fall, we had over 500 people in attendance at the Milton Community Activities Fair which invites community members to become involved in over 50 local service and non-profit organizations.
• 135 people participated in the Milton Girls Day which encourages girls in 3rd-8th grade to connect with the important women in their lives to nurture their interests.
The Milton Community Youth Coalition is largely funded by state, federal and foundation grants. We are fortunate to have such great supporters of prevention here in Milton!
